Gorasahi in context

With 267 people at the 2011 Census, Gorasahi was the 574th most populous of its district's 1187 villages, below the district average of 354.

Literacy stood at 54.26%, 16.6 points below the district's rural average of 70.84%.

The sex ratio was 1086 women per 1,000 men (93 above the district's rural figure of 993)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 833, 90 below the rural national 923.

63.7% of the population were recorded as workers, 13.2 points above the district's rural rate.
